Method for monitoring intermediate regenerators (ZWR) which include a digital signal regenerator (DR) and a thelemetry signal regenerator (TR), between two line terminal devices of a digital transmission system, wherein telemetry signals are transmitted separately for each transmission direction via the same signal path as the digital data signals but in a different frequency position, wherein the first telemetry signal regenerator (TR), which does not receive a telemetry signal, cyclically transmits its own telemetry signal, and the telemetry signal regenerator (TR) of each following intermediate regenerator (ZWR) generates a telemetry signal which adjoins the last received telemetry signal and which includes results of a fault monitoring procedure, wherein a monitoring of the received and transmitted telemetry signal (TS) is carried out, and at the receiving-end line terminal device the intermediate regenerators (ZWR) are localised by counting the telemetry signals, characterised in that each telemetry signal regenerator (TR) generates a telemetry signal (TS) comprising at least one start block (S), a fault block (F) and a test block (P), that in known manner monitoring results of the transmission link and of the particular digital signal regenerator (DR) are transmitted in the fault block (F) of the associated telemetry signal (TS), that fault monitoring devices (UEC, UE2) of the digital signal regenerator (DR) are self-monitored by the simulation of faults, and that the result of the self-monitoring is transmitted in the test block (P) of the associated telemetry signal (TS).</p> |
